From f85e9ba691ae534c6b129b4e7e93299c101cd8cc Mon Sep 17 00:00:00 2001
From: BlockMen <nmuelll@web.de>
Date: Thu, 17 Apr 2014 14:14:56 +0200
Subject: [PATCH] Add mese and diamond hoe, new tool textures

---
 mods/farming/README.txt                       |   4 +-
 mods/farming/init.lua                         |  36 ++++++++++++++++++
 .../textures/farming_tool_bronzehoe.png       | Bin 242 -> 308 bytes
 .../textures/farming_tool_diamondhoe.png      | Bin 0 -> 299 bytes
 .../farming/textures/farming_tool_mesehoe.png | Bin 0 -> 277 bytes
 .../textures/farming_tool_steelhoe.png        | Bin 248 -> 278 bytes
 .../textures/farming_tool_stonehoe.png        | Bin 257 -> 296 bytes
 .../farming/textures/farming_tool_woodhoe.png | Bin 217 -> 270 bytes
 8 files changed, 39 insertions(+), 1 deletion(-)
 create mode 100644 mods/farming/textures/farming_tool_diamondhoe.png
 create mode 100644 mods/farming/textures/farming_tool_mesehoe.png

diff --git a/mods/farming/README.txt b/mods/farming/README.txt
index b92e0be..75521b2 100644
--- a/mods/farming/README.txt
+++ b/mods/farming/README.txt
@@ -28,7 +28,9 @@ Created by PilzAdam (License: WTFPL):
   farming_soil_wet_side.png
   farming_string.png
 
-Created by Calinou (License: CC BY-SA):
+Created by BlockMen (License: CC BY 3.0):
+  farming_tool_diamondhoe.png
+  farming_tool_mesehoe.png
   farming_tool_bronzehoe.png
   farming_tool_steelhoe.png
   farming_tool_stonehoe.png
diff --git a/mods/farming/init.lua b/mods/farming/init.lua
index 4a2df19..31cacc4 100644
--- a/mods/farming/init.lua
+++ b/mods/farming/init.lua
@@ -142,6 +142,24 @@ minetest.register_tool("farming:hoe_bronze", {
 	end,
 })
 
+minetest.register_tool("farming:hoe_mese", {
+	description = "Mese Hoe",
+	inventory_image = "farming_tool_mesehoe.png",
+	
+	on_use = function(itemstack, user, pointed_thing)
+		return farming.hoe_on_use(itemstack, user, pointed_thing, 350)
+	end,
+})
+
+minetest.register_tool("farming:hoe_diamond", {
+	description = "Diamond Hoe",
+	inventory_image = "farming_tool_diamondhoe.png",
+	
+	on_use = function(itemstack, user, pointed_thing)
+		return farming.hoe_on_use(itemstack, user, pointed_thing, 500)
+	end,
+})
+
 minetest.register_craft({
 	output = "farming:hoe_wood",
 	recipe = {
@@ -178,6 +196,24 @@ minetest.register_craft({
 	}
 })
 
+minetest.register_craft({
+	output = "farming:hoe_mese",
+	recipe = {
+		{"default:mese_crystal", "default:mese_crystal"},
+		{"", "group:stick"},
+		{"", "group:stick"},
+	}
+})
+
+minetest.register_craft({
+	output = "farming:hoe_diamond",
+	recipe = {
+		{"default:diamond", "default:diamond"},
+		{"", "group:stick"},
+		{"", "group:stick"},
+	}
+})
+
 --
 -- Override grass for drops
 --
diff --git a/mods/farming/textures/farming_tool_bronzehoe.png b/mods/farming/textures/farming_tool_bronzehoe.png
index 140fb64ddccb9c594aa67ed42fdafb2ef7daa016..ed10a595897bb661d0c520e58819e5d1914e65c3 100644
GIT binary patch
delta 281
zcmV+!0p|Yl0ki^;B!3BTNLh0L01m?d01m?e$8V@)0002yNkl<Zc${PS|NlP&C79v=
z|NjgVzMW^dTcZ2_VY$KoeaQ;{-*x)^|3AOz|KW0-{}aBQXF$hT4M4`5W2OH;Z*u$p
zzuor#<!S>Ag9sXcY|#I9+yDRP7yUm|Z1F$PQs%##uIPWF4S#?c^0d+Q|ECGj{|{zr
z|F>2ZAkBaY-_A2wYl{4z=Ewj4euLZp&9Ty?8Q`oh{@>q}_rIYc-~Y|A(*H>cgFs7}
z|2dw*{|)7MNe@JrW@}XejHo1N06xtG4Irc$uK~np#%Tbtnz0%H(`=?hSTj}w%#;L(
f){NBvN-zKvQxbdC?BGQu00000NkvXXu0mjfk$;f5

delta 214
zcmdnO^oenTN<CYWx4R3&e-K=-cll%n1_sUokH}&M2EHR8%s5q>PZ}u5UgGKN%6^ws
zlvj~yxm1<_P^jM1#WBR<baKK1u^;x15ABWAZZD9u<N438Vi1rgaYkWAV%@T?|H-+b
z|0d@OoM`Ydzx&_MYt9nsB#omV<s~OCk$jRfVXgnEMROFU8#EZ4oHcO|vl)Yg+LG)x
z#zirW-o~4>Ph9GG!?os~f}62l_yj3e1!s?KlKD!C)}JTj8jCP6NUO$ca%Y>r1iFR6
M)78&qol`;+0C^5frT_o{

diff --git a/mods/farming/textures/farming_tool_diamondhoe.png b/mods/farming/textures/farming_tool_diamondhoe.png
new file mode 100644
index 0000000000000000000000000000000000000000..401d713c01dc18d021a2f473944806d2dbbba010
GIT binary patch
literal 299
zcmeAS@N?(olHy`uVBq!ia0vp^0wB!61|;P_|4#%`oCO|{#S9F5he4R}c>anMpx|9k
z7srr_IZH3va~(2}X?qy6AgJS!Qj-&VyMnC9lF4E$u`1sK3OIK<w?C5nW6Z%9RK*u4
zvm{-^_V9Cs)<s)AUwlZdp8rssso~1a=ZQ@pESRP;<%lQ!u4y<fSRvDB;J7cGOT>NY
zfoFBj6P7->D0=#|q?>~v*Cr98%7gZ@2h?THL~`G9==15XW{K>&`I6!M#<L8ESU$4(
zZiwZWxyNCt0rQ_k>D3ciw_j(N%H(GLU^3q|Zm#XwGvy8YZIA!^>7^PVs?8W0!};P!
tJ>%USA}1af#>-A;dc1EfkSzVimbqoO>IDhIB%ntbJYD@<);T3K0RWLZaR2}S

literal 0
HcmV?d00001

diff --git a/mods/farming/textures/farming_tool_mesehoe.png b/mods/farming/textures/farming_tool_mesehoe.png
new file mode 100644
index 0000000000000000000000000000000000000000..245b7d5c207a9272751ccb7e9acc082ff3752c0b
GIT binary patch
literal 277
zcmeAS@N?(olHy`uVBq!ia0vp^0wB!61|;P_|4#%`oCO|{#S9F5he4R}c>anMpx|*&
z7srr_IZH3@<!TC$X#e<~jcef|HclZKDJ2;prwq=fWfR)+l=f=mAMuTuJu8Z97t_Iy
znH;|_*|^L6d;IzF2RX(iXIUngaH*bdwGhnvF1Ud`EM?~ew}pS!3H`Vu&2^$k)6r|e
zjh8wO3@kD0n)aLAJj0g3e1E-Vffe_>TodL?8Y20(>hG%iEs@+XkN>8wmBnPe!cTiz
z%^v9c_T82{x8w4k4%as~-Ck->b%<TV5>lwUK=?mv$z!ht9kJfB;Y{mNGmcMnm~G1-
Y8SHc5WUI$ipqCgtUHx3vIVCg!0JQsQw*UYD

literal 0
HcmV?d00001

diff --git a/mods/farming/textures/farming_tool_steelhoe.png b/mods/farming/textures/farming_tool_steelhoe.png
index c19afb85668a302fafe954e777db52a9f5cf75a1..9ae231aac1abf4479f1b6b1ad6b6e9941afae9ba 100644
GIT binary patch
delta 250
zcmV<W00sZ}0hR)gB!3BTNLh0L01m?d01m?e$8V@)0002UNkl<Zc$}rtF^a-a6ouip
z0Yku%X=FgbVhWKIBgiWS!AjhRi^@jM4(=*$AZ>~iDSxZTFcZxS7N`6_9`^+xyt4p=
zGG@Wuk%YU`bsc7gB+8hDzZ(R8PZD)q1K{qM8Iyp1W=7k#0CSib*Ta(2c0n@GzeW;G
z(_m)AO+F1MV;17~2a>3&3Q5y|<L;Bo&x~S~J&u|TTn|fb=Q+jKZ2A%VIBxQPUpWfA
zibsL5_$81MKLt|bL7<QK>+yIH*st^Cco2AJcP+2)Qf^-s%m4rY07*qoM6N<$g5&yb
AV*mgE

delta 220
zcmbQn^n-DNN<CYWx4R3&e-K=-cll%n1_sUokH}&M2EHR8%s5q>PZ}u5UgGKN%6^BN
zO;|`{#iqNKK%rJo7sn8b)5!@7#40{NJ6oUPv&~W3Eayl4von&Xc$p<jK0Wa?V3T~5
zzUqhlwXmo5H`y9_PLy2!`+mt0&s~abK{Ed*8hVD#ay-X&bCu31&LU1`j>&5zPg*B1
z$L+84-IXSxa7uKCiSq6yowFy_9eBl?Wb(L#b!8xnQA^6~k7`1jjQMYxIWscM+tctZ
TQCD9F=pqJBS3j3^P6<r_x`kDH

diff --git a/mods/farming/textures/farming_tool_stonehoe.png b/mods/farming/textures/farming_tool_stonehoe.png
index 741f190dc3666fd81cbb7097508bcfcdb31d54e6..f6b5b2a1cab97c202439b34444626c938b822d0b 100644
GIT binary patch
delta 269
zcmV+o0rLKV0;mFzB!3BTNLh0L01m?d01m?e$8V@)0002mNkl<Zc$}rtziNX}7>4n4
z133t3=@JSF$<QH`3=IS!OR<ot<QhJ4@`yP22L;6|@(!O&2MRUOLxy)cJip;P3Q*5X
z0cr@e8Un5Ay2cno*LC!LPm(0qx4*j!*u`;7Q4~~FMVh7<V}Ec0?7}dlEK8cE;k@;@
zo>u(qUzrUIfmTrzAtGd1hKS(rJU3tnwDLb*Xxo-N&k+$f;QRB9->(ISwMIm6y216d
zBEBp+yf563Xk&lp{rk#E;88pYOvMj@Iq_X!ZafOu__&#lM}gzUn;nk=&+G=7THU^n
TL-!y60000<MFvhpu0mjf2*!3`

delta 229
zcmZ3%)W|eJrJgOx+ueoXKL{?^yL>VO0|RG)M`SSr1K$x4W}K?cCk+&2FY)wsWxvDC
zCM;yI`<`n)P^iz-#WBR<baKK1u^A?rm;SGf-ri)`;k(UIP*CuHadGkg!#pat4Q4nR
z9KNIT_5bl(t0v^lm_7S;{e(mXW}~|$|E)C(C*{R;EEG9jpW-tqZNg^9ZCPFgje8C=
z98$@4;}YM%c)&n0)|f}&DOb#_g^gYJ8ER%tjBUIseI(=9ORk{B94Q<p%^v%zq@>Gj
d%57s}cp;M1IE&%zd!W-8JYD@<);T3K0RXfzS|9)b

diff --git a/mods/farming/textures/farming_tool_woodhoe.png b/mods/farming/textures/farming_tool_woodhoe.png
index 2448c181089ab9257fd08b17d45a73051f7bb715..21838a2452095a4b5735b713b4ce2331b5e4d58a 100644
GIT binary patch
delta 242
zcmV<O01f}y0geKYB!3BTNLh0L01m?d01m?e$8V@)0002MNkl<Zc$}rtu?mAQ6ouhz
zPLV(?LJ>j5p+hMdB8WO!0#4%Cu3Ea}VSS_1p+tmQjX0bs{NHdx0FWai0LWN6(;k(N
z;qIYV33S6Te=}PJ4AM%9w>m>N9M8(dF2Jmn6unCDQXzE1(QD-a)b#{wU@RR{Ts*Xr
zVyGEJ<f2H~K46Ztl0ro8KA^t&Qz)YEEv$hq51<<k5z_rfG;xu#pRe2m*5XZID_#X`
s;=h1xya<>$i?`!NAd8uGya*iG2bILuIfZDtZU6uP07*qoM6N<$f|<W(_y7O^

delta 189
zcmeBUy2&^}rJgOx+ueoXKL{?^yL>VO0|RG)M`SSr1K$x4W}K?cCk+&2FY)wsWxvDC
zCM;xmi0SWXpir8pi(`mIZ*sx{u@fbi|K1nL<2$Bcc9ZR9me=3!reS~hjVI(BPGCF8
zQ@r`gfBEdyPP-D@xEB3)Y-{9UkbJV_h-aH(kc`>?iH4rD9M7@cT%~!?b=O&gvnts#
nD`%bTTGY5*lI6rUNiK%D-(7!M`w2<_tz__Y^>bP0l+XkKg*!-p